These are the second most common white blood cell (20-50%), and are easy to find in blood smears. Although the cells look similar there are two main types, B-cells and T-cells. Normally, mature erythrocytes have a rounded, biconcave shape that is flexible enough for the small cells to squeeze through even the smallest of blood vessels. Now automated digital systems may be used to help examine blood smears.
